    As a country develops, its people usually enjoy better health care, drink cleaner water, and have more food. However, people's lifestyle is changing at the same time. They have busier lives. They eat more processed food, which has more fat, salt, and sugar. As a result, the number of people with certain illnesses is increasing.

    Diabetes(糖尿病) is an illness that has become more common. According to the WHO, the number of diabetes patients in the world rose by nearly 4% from 1980 to 2014. And the number is still rising.

    In the past, diabetes was more common in rich countries. However, in recent years, the number has been rising more rapidly in developing countries. Take China for example. In 1980, less than 1% of the population in China had diabetes, but now more than one in ten Chinese over 18 have diabetes.

    It is possible to control diabetes with medicine, but there is no cure. There are things, however, that people can do to avoid it. If they are overweight, they should try to lose weight. They should also avoid foods high in fat and sugar. People should exercise often. Besides, they should walk or ride bikes more instead of traveling by car. If people change to this healthier lifestyle, we may be able to stop the rise in diabetes in the future.

    Do you ever give up easily in difficult situations? If so, imagine yourself as someone with great abilities, like Batman. It will help you feel strong. You will not give up easily and will probably do better. This is called the Batman Effect.

    In a study, researchers gave three groups of six-year-old children a difficult task to complete on a computer. In Group One, the children were told to repeat asking themselves, "Am I working hard?" In Group Two, the children were told to ask themselves the same question in the third person—as in "Is Sam working hard?" And in Group Three, the children were told to imagine themselves as Batman and ask themselves, "Is Batman working hard?" Researchers found that the children in Group Three did the best.

    How can you make use of the Batman Effect? Imagine yourself as someone who is the best for the task you are doing. If you're facing a personal difficulty, imagine yourself as a wise family member. If you're running a race at school, imagine yourself as a top runner. In this way, you can become a little more like the person you wish to be.
